Smart Thermostats Market Scope:
By type, the market is segmented into 99$, 100$-200$, and Over 200$. By application, the market is divided into Residential, Office Building, Educational Institution, and Others.
Based on geography, market is analyzed across North America, Europe, Asia-Pacific, Latin America, and Middle East and Africa. Major players profiled in the report include Nest, Honeywell, Ecobee, Tado, Lux Products, Netatmo, Hive Home, Siemens, Emerson Electric, and Vivint.
